Welcome to exciting adventures in Slope Ball. A planet is destroyed by 5 monsters who are T-Rex Tyrannosaurus, Giant Snake Titanoboa, Flying Monster Quetzalcoatlus, Ferocious Bear Megatherium, and the Shark Megalodon. Come and save this planet now. Guide the ball to jump over various deadly obstacles along the way. During the adventure, you will have to pass through many portals which can change your appearance and features. No matter what appearance, your ultimate goal is to get to the destination and defeat all monsters. Break a leg!

Slope Ball Gameplay Guide

Use a mouse click or press the up arrow key to jump.

Top Game Features

- Six kinds of cool characters including cubes, ships, balls, UFOs, robots, and waves.
- Five maps with 11 challenging levels.
- Various dangerous obstacles and traps along the way.
- Eight portals (Cube portals, Shipportal, Ball portal, UFO portal, Wave portal, Robot portal, and Spider portal).
- Beautiful 2D graphics and catchy music.
